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Deltona
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Phantom Damage
Scammer inspects and exaggerates minor issues as major failures needing full replacement.
Upfront Payment Trap
Demands large cash deposit before starting work, then does minimal fixes or disappears.
Bait-and-Switch Pricing
Low phone quote, but on-site claims surprise costs and upsells expensive parts.
Fake Parts Replacement
Replaces working parts with cheap fakes, pockets the difference on your bill.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Request a certificate of insurance showing general li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er directly to verify it's active and covers the work.
Licensing
Check the Florida DBPR website at myfloridalicense.com using their license number. For Deltona in Volusia County, confirm with the local building department if additional permits are needed.
References
Ask for 3 recent local references in Deltona or nearby. Contact them to verify quality, punctuality, and overall satisfaction.
